Laura, really the only problem with consuming so much Stevia is that it is maintaining a sweet palette so that you still crave/like sweet things. Stevia is essentially calorie and carbohydrate free, and studies have shown that it has other benefits with things like blood sugar regulation, hypertension, and can possibly help fight diabetes and obesity.
